github使用教程图文详解
时间: 2023-08-17 09:05:52 浏览: 82
好的,下面是 Github 使用教程的图文详解:
1. 注册Github账号
访问Github网站,点击右上角的“Sign up”按钮,填写注册信息并完成注册。
2. 创建仓库
登录Github账号后,点击页面右上角的“+”按钮,选择“New repository”,填写仓库信息并点击“Create repository”。
3. 上传文件
在仓库页面点击“Upload files”按钮,选择文件并上传。
4. 编辑文件
在仓库页面点击需要编辑的文件,点击编辑按钮进行修改。
5. 提交修改
在编辑页面完成修改后,填写提交信息并点击“Commit changes”按钮提交修改。
6. 分支管理
在仓库页面点击“Branch:master”按钮,选择需要创建的分支,并进行修改。
7. 合并代码
在分支页面点击“New pull request”按钮,填写合并信息并提交申请。
8. 发布版本
在仓库页面点击“Releases”按钮,填写版本信息并发布版本。
以上就是 Github 使用教程的图文详解,希望对你有所帮助。
相关问题
git使用教程图文详解
Git 是一个分布式版本控制系统,用于协同开发和管理代码。下面是一个简单的图文教程,帮助你入门 Git 的基本使用。
1. 安装 Git:
首先,你需要在你的计算机上安装 Git。你可以在 Git 官方网站下载适合你操作系统的安装包,并按照安装向导进行安装。
2. 配置用户信息:
安装完成后,打开命令行终端,配置你的用户信息。使用以下命令设置你的用户名和邮箱:
```
git config --global user.name "Your Name"
git config --global user.email "your@email.com"
```
3. 创建一个新的仓库:
在命令行终端中,进入你要管理的项目文件夹,并初始化一个新的 Git 仓库:
```
cd /path/to/your/project
git init
```
4. 添加文件到暂存区:
将项目中的文件添加到 Git 的暂存区,以便跟踪文件的修改:
```
git add file1.txt file2.txt
```
5. 提交修改:
提交暂存区中的修改到本地仓库:
```
git commit -m "Commit message"
```
6. 创建远程仓库:
在 Git 托管服务(如 GitHub、GitLab)上创建一个远程仓库,并获取远程仓库的 URL。
7. 关联远程仓库:
将本地仓库与远程仓库进行关联:
```
git remote add origin remote_repository_url
```
8. 推送修改:
将本地仓库中的修改推送到远程仓库:
```
git push origin master
```
9. 克隆仓库:
如果你想获取已有的远程仓库到本地,可以使用克隆命令:
```
git clone remote_repository_url
```
10. 拉取更新:
如果其他人对远程仓库进行了修改,你可以使用拉取命令将这些修改更新到本地仓库:
```
git pull origin master
```
这只是 Git 的基本使用教程,还有很多高级功能和命令可以深入学习。你可以参考官方文档或其他教程来进一步了解 Git 的使用。
github hexo搭建博客
使用Github hexo搭建个人博客的过程可以分为以下几个步骤:
1. 准备工作:首先需要安装两个必要的软件,一个是Git用于版本控制,另一个是Node.js用于运行Hexo。可以在官网下载并安装这两个软件。
2. 注册Github账号以及建立仓库:在Github官网上注册一个账号,并创建一个仓库用于存储博客的代码和文件。
3. 本地配置安装Hexo:在本地电脑上配置Hexo环境。打开命令行界面,使用npm安装Hexo,然后初始化Hexo项目。
4. 设置ssh:为了能够将本地的代码推送到Github仓库中,需要设置SSH密钥。可以通过命令行生成SSH密钥,并将公钥添加到Github账号的设置中。
5. 上传测试博客:在本地编写博客的内容,然后使用Hexo命令生成静态页面,并将生成的页面推送到Github仓库中。
以上就是使用Github hexo搭建个人博客的基本步骤。具体的每个步骤可以参考中提供的教程。值得注意的是,如果想要让博客更加美观和炫酷,可以在网上下载一些好看的主题样式,并进行相应的配置。同时,还可以使用hexo-abbrlink等插件来增加博客的功能[2]。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* *2* [Github+Hexo搭建个人博客(图文详解)](https://blog.csdn.net/weixin_45377770/article/details/105228938)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"]
- *3* [hexo+github搭建博客(超级详细版,精细入微)](https://blog.csdn.net/victoryxa/article/details/103733655)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"]
[ .reference_list ]